Buying Guide for Tomatillos in a Can

Why I Choose Canned Tomatillos

When I’m looking to add a zesty kick to my dishes, canned tomatillos are my go-to. They provide the unique tart flavor that fresh tomatillos offer, but with the convenience of being shelf-stable. Canned tomatillos save me time in the kitchen, especially when I’m in a rush.

What to Look For

When I shop for canned tomatillos, I pay attention to a few key factors. First, I look at the ingredient list. Ideally, it should be simple, containing just tomatillos, water, and possibly salt. I avoid products with unnecessary preservatives or additives.

Next, I check the can for any signs of damage. Dents, rust, or bulging can indicate that the contents might not be safe to eat. I also make sure to look for cans that are labeled as “organic” if that’s important to me.

Understanding the Label

Reading the label helps me understand the product better. I always check the expiration date to ensure freshness. The nutritional information is also crucial for my dietary needs. I pay attention to the sodium content, as some brands can be quite high.

How to Use Canned Tomatillos

I love the versatility of canned tomatillos in my cooking. They can be used in salsas, soups, and sauces. I often blend them into a quick salsa verde or toss them into a stew for added flavor.

One of my favorite uses is adding them to tacos or enchiladas. The tangy flavor really elevates the dish. I also enjoy using them in marinades for meats, as they add a wonderful depth.

Storage Tips

Once I open a can of tomatillos, I always transfer any leftovers into an airtight container. I store them in the refrigerator and try to use them within a few days for the best flavor and quality.

If I have an unopened can, I keep it in my pantry, away from direct sunlight and heat, to ensure it stays fresh as long as possible.
